X-men: the last stand (or is it?!)


Just went and saw X-men 3 and it was excellent! However, I do have many problems with it. First of all, you could so tell that Bryan Singer (director of the first two) didn't direct this one. The pace was too fast, the visuals weren't as good and there was only one or two spots where I really liked the cinematography. Second, character usage and development. There was an addition of new characters in this one but if you didn't know them from the comics, etc., then you wouldn't really know who they were. Not only that, but they barely had a role or point to the movie. Colossus had maybe 4 lines in the movie, wasn't russian (like he's supposed to be) and had no significant role to the movie. Multiple Man was pointless as well. Then there's the characters we already know, some of them have no point being in the movie either. Rogue, barely in the movie, has no real significance to anything, why bother with her. Mystique, after the first 15 minutes it was like they couldn't figure what else to do with her. Don't get me wrong this movie was entertaining, definitely a good follow up to the last two but it just seemed to cram to much for no reason. OH, and if you haven't seen it yet and are planning to go, stay til after the credits. There is a nice little easter egg. It's only about 10 seconds long but it's worth it. If you have seen it and didn't see the easter egg, message me and i'll tell you about it. Anywho that's my review on that.
